Does grout hold bacteria?

Grout is a porous material that is commonly used to fill the gaps between tiles in floors, walls, and countertops. It is made from a mixture of cement, water, and sand, and is used to create a durable and attractive finish in a variety of settings. However, because it is porous, grout is also prone to accumulating dirt, stains, and bacteria. This raises the question: does grout hold bacteria, and if so, what can be done to prevent it from becoming a breeding ground for harmful microorganisms?

There are several factors that can influence the presence and proliferation of bacteria in grout. One of the most important is the level of cleanliness and hygiene in the area where the grout is installed. Grout that is exposed to dirty water, food spills, or other contaminants is more likely to harbor bacteria than grout that is kept clean and dry. Similarly, grout that is installed in areas with high levels of humidity or moisture, such as bathrooms and kitchens, may be more prone to bacterial growth.

In addition to the cleanliness of the area, the type of grout used can also affect the presence of bacteria. Some types of grout, such as epoxy grout, are more resistant to bacterial growth than others, such as cement-based grout. Epoxy grout is made from a mixture of epoxy resins and fillers, and is known for its durability and resistance to stains and bacteria. It is often used in high-traffic areas, such as commercial kitchens and hospitals, where it is important to minimize the risk of bacterial contamination.

Despite its resistance to bacteria, however, even epoxy grout can become contaminated if it is not properly maintained. Regular cleaning and disinfection are essential to prevent the buildup of dirt, stains, and bacteria in grout. This can be done using a variety of methods, including scrubbing with a mild detergent and water, using a steam cleaner, or applying a commercial grout cleaner. It is important to choose a cleaning method that is appropriate for the type of grout and the level of contamination.

One of the most effective ways to prevent the buildup of bacteria in grout is to seal it. Grout sealing is a process that involves applying a protective coating to the surface of the grout, which helps to prevent dirt, stains, and bacteria from penetrating the pores of the material. There are a number of different types of grout sealers available, including water-based and solvent-based sealers, and it is important to choose one that is appropriate for the type of grout and the intended use. Grout sealers should be reapplied on a regular basis, typically every one to three years, depending on the level of wear and tear.

In summary, grout can hold bacteria if it is not properly maintained and protected. However, by following proper cleaning and disinfection procedures, and by sealing the grout, it is possible to minimize the risk of bacterial contamination and keep your grout looking clean and fresh. Regular maintenance and care are essential to ensuring that your grout stays healthy and hygienic.
